Transaction 975e81f3a8855627f990dc5610576d183f1666decb005495d90d192801416ff1

1 Input
2 Outputs
  • 975e81f3a8855627f990dc5610576d183f1666decb005495d90d192801416ff1:0
  • value  661400
    address  16e5h3egqUsxSbTE7Wi7ypRERZ5swUiNmc
  • 975e81f3a8855627f990dc5610576d183f1666decb005495d90d192801416ff1:1
  • value  41980
    address  393b4PPSiMRTYY2snB4f62zNgh7rG5UeG3